Triple Crown

Triple Crown is one of the Main Line’s most exciting additions. It’s an elevated, Ralph Lauren–inspired space with generous nods to the iconic Devon Horse Show just down the road. Rich tones, tailored design elements, and an atmosphere of polished sophistication make Triple Crown feel both modern and timeless.

Couples can exchange vows in the garden setting, or glass conservatory year-round. It brings the outdoors in through light, greenery, and sweeping views. The spacious ballroom offers a refined backdrop for dinner and dancing, blending classic Main Line elegance with contemporary warmth.

With on-site guest rooms and suites at The Radnor Hotel, Triple Crown delivers a seamless, stylish experience in the heart of the Main Line.

Pomme

Pomme is a converted Main Line clubhouse tucked into lush greenery, woods, and serene water features. Its year-round newly constructed veranda overlooks the pond, stream, and canopy of mature trees. You’ll find it’s an idyllic choice for couples dreaming of a garden wedding.

One of its most distinctive features is the bridal suite, uniquely located in a converted wine cellar. Inside, Pomme’s ballroom blends contemporary style with elegant-rustic touches, redefining what a traditional ballroom can be.
Top-notch Peachtree Catering is exclusive to this stunning wedding venue, ensuring an exceptional culinary experience.

The Barn at Valley Forge Flowers

Although situated within Eagle Village Shopping Center, The Barn at Valley Forge Flowers feels miles away from suburban bustle. Its tranquil, rustic-yet-classic atmosphere makes it one of the most unique Main Line wedding venues. It’s practically a secret because it’s within a floral and retail shop that flips into an event venue after hours. Imagine herringbone brick pathways, nooks, rustic touches.

Ideal for private gatherings of 10 or receptions up to 150, The Barn at Valley Forge Flowers offers charm at every corner. The newly opened Cottage adds even more character. Each space adorned with greenery, blooms, and outdoor accents. An in-house event planner from Valley Forge Flowers oversees linens, lighting, rentals, catering and naturally, your florals.

The Saturday Club

This 1898 Tudor clubhouse sits in the heart of Wayne and radiates charm. The ballroom features hardwood floors, cathedral ceilings, a fireplace, window seats, and an elevated stage ideal for romantic first dances or live entertainment.

With a get ready room and full kitchen, The Saturday Club offers convenience alongside architectural beauty.
